Highway 61 bid higher than expected

Nov 27, 2019
The cost for the Highway 61 reconstruction project is headed upward, but it’s not clear what, if any, additional costs will be borne by the City of Lake City. Rochester Sand and Gravel was the sole bidder for the 2020 Highway 61 reconstruction project in Lake City. The bid amount is just under $14...

Pedestrian traffic accidents are rare in Lake City, but concerns remain

Oct 30, 2019
Around the United States, traffic fatalites are on the rise. According to a Governors Highway Safety Association report, 6,227 pedestrians were killed in traffic accidents in 2018, the most since 1990. In Lake City, accidents between cars and pedestrians or non-motorized vehicles have been rare....
